Lek's Kitchen-Takeaway and Restaurant is located in Tongaat, South Africa on 23 Krishna Desai Cir, Waterways. Lek's Kitchen-Takeaway and Restaurant is rated 3 out of 5 in the category restaurant in South Africa.
Address
23 Krishna Desai Cir, Waterways
Service options
TakeawayDine-in